For My People by Ndine Emma Song Details

Ndine Emma's ' "For My People" was released on its scheduled release date, August 30, 2025. The duration of This song is about two minutes long, specifically at 2:21. This song does not appear to have any foul language. For My People's duration is considered a little bit shorter than the average duration of a typical track. The track order of this song in Ndine Emma's "Matero in the House" album is number 1 out of 14. On top of that, Turks and Caicos Islands appears to be the country where this track was created. In terms of popularity, For My People is currently unknown. The overall tone is very danceable, especially with its high energy, which produces more of a euphoric, cheerful, or happy vibe.

BPM and Tempo

We consider the tempo marking of For My People by Ndine Emma to be Andante (at a walking pace) because the track has a tempo of 102 BPM, a half-time of 51BPM, and a double-time of 204 BPM. Based on that, the speed of the song's tempo is slow. The time signature for this track is 4/4.

Music Key

This song has a musical key of C Minor. Because this track belongs in the C Minor key, the camelot key is 5A. So, the perfect camelot match for 5A would be either 5A or 4B. While, a low energy boost can consist of either 5B or 6A. For moderate energy boost, you would use 2A and a high energy boost can either be 7A or 12A. However, if you are looking for a low energy drop, finding a song with a camelot key of 4A would be a great choice. Where 8A would give you a moderate drop, and 3A or 10A would be a high energy drop. Lastly, 8B allows you to change the mood.

Want to find the BPM and music key for other songs? Check out our BPM and Key Finder page!

Popularity
Loudness
-6.627 dB
Acousticness
66%
Danceability
67%
Energy
68%
Instrumentalness
0%
Liveness
23%
Loudness
89%
Speechiness
10%
Valence
71%

Recommendations

TrackArtistKeyEnergyCamelotBPM
Umuti by S Roxxy, Vinchenzo M’bale, Triple MUmutiS Roxxy, Vinchenzo M’bale, Triple MB♭ Major66B107 BPM
Lingo (Munkoyo) by AqualaskinLingo (Munkoyo)AqualaskinB Minor810A121 BPM
Nshakubepe by T-Low, Blood KidNshakubepeT-Low, Blood KidB♭ Minor73A103 BPM
Bhobho by Emm ZibryBhobhoEmm ZibryD♭ Major63B91 BPM
Dzinali (feat. Dizmo, Coxy, Chewe, Goddy) by Slapdee, Chewe, Coxy, Dizmo, GoddyDzinali (feat. Dizmo, Coxy, Chewe, Goddy)Slapdee, Chewe, Coxy, Dizmo, GoddyG Major49B85 BPM
Kwiyo by Dough Major, Dingo Duke, Lloyd SoulKwiyoDough Major, Dingo Duke, Lloyd SoulF Major87B112 BPM
Eagle One by Chile One Mr ZambiaEagle OneChile One Mr ZambiaF♯ Major72B140 BPM
Lutanda by BrokenHill EmmyLutandaBrokenHill EmmyF Major57B97 BPM
Too Young by DJ Mzenga Man, Y Cool, Slick BowyToo YoungDJ Mzenga Man, Y Cool, Slick BowyB Minor510A184 BPM
Through the Darkest Times by 76 Drums, Triiga AceThrough the Darkest Times76 Drums, Triiga AceF Minor94A155 BPM
Kagwele uko! by Zeze Kingston, Leumas, Hayze EngolaKagwele uko!Zeze Kingston, Leumas, Hayze EngolaD Major610B112 BPM
Babay Yaga by JemaxBabay YagaJemaxA Minor98A82 BPM
KE FODILE by Vsinare, Ice cueKE FODILEVsinare, Ice cueF♯ Major82B146 BPM
Politrix by RapchaPolitrixRapchaD Major510B80 BPM
Fame by Young LunyaFameYoung LunyaB♭ Minor73A142 BPM
Buyer by Jay Trek, Ndine EmmaBuyerJay Trek, Ndine EmmaF♯ Major82B109 BPM
Not Anymore by LandroseNot AnymoreLandroseE Minor89A116 BPM
Intro by Jemax, VinchenzoIntroJemax, VinchenzoC Major88B100 BPM
Ghetto Olo Mayadi by Ndine Emma, LyriQ ElayyGhetto Olo MayadiNdine Emma, LyriQ ElayyC Minor75A136 BPM
Ije Nwoke by MR DYANIje NwokeMR DYAND Major810B85 BPM
Ifot Bustaz by Upper X, Jonnykage, Young BoneIfot BustazUpper X, Jonnykage, Young BoneA Major711B146 BPM
SWAG OBI by SWAGFOCUSSWAG OBISWAGFOCUSC Major68B116 BPM
Rizler and Lighter by Dizmo, EmteeRizler and LighterDizmo, EmteeC Major78B98 BPM
Sitili Same Same (Ghetto story) by Y-coolSitili Same Same (Ghetto story)Y-coolB♭ Minor93A142 BPM
Better Than You by Slick Bowy, Bow ChaseBetter Than YouSlick Bowy, Bow ChaseF♯ Major82B99 BPM
ISRC
TCAJZ2591776
Label
L-M Records/RCA Records